Matlock Way is in New Malden and in Kingston Upon Thames district. KT3 3AY is located in the Coombe Vale elect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Richmond Park.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ding KT3 3AY,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.4%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of KT3 3AY there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 66.2%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Safety

Is Matlock Way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Matlock Way was 33.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 62.7% lower than the Coombe Hill average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Matlock Way has the 7th lowest crime rate of 19 local areas in Coombe Hill and the 169th lowest crime rate of 475 local areas in Kingston upon Thames .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 3.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-46.8%.
